Idea app come svilupparla: Dall’idea alla realizzazione del progetto

Hai un’idea brillante per un’app ma non sai come trasformarla in realtà? Nel 2022, il mercato delle app mobili ha raggiunto un giro d’affari di oltre 150 miliardi di dollari, dimostrando enormi opportunità per chi vuole sviluppare un’app innovativa.

Sviluppare un’app richiede una strategia chiara. Che tu sia un imprenditore digitale o un creativo con una visione unica, il percorso per trasformare un’idea app in un prodotto funzionale passa attraverso varie fasi cruciali.

La chiave per avere successo quando non sai come sviluppare un’app è pianificare accuratamente. Dovrai analizzare il mercato, convalidare la tua idea e scegliere la tecnologia più adatta alle tue esigenze.

In questa guida completa, ti accompagneremo passo dopo passo nel processo di creazione della tua app, dalla concezione iniziale fino al lancio sul mercato. Scoprirai strategie, metodologie e consigli pratici per portare la tua idea app da un semplice concetto a un’applicazione di successo.


Dall’idea alla realtà: Il processo su come sviluppare un’app

Quando inizi a pensare “ho un’app da sviluppare”, è fondamentale comprendere che il percorso dalla concezione alla realizzazione richiede una strategia chiara e mirata. Come sviluppare un’idea di app non è un processo casuale, ma un percorso metodico che richiede attenzione e pianificazione accurata.

Il primo passo cruciale nel tuo viaggio è la validazione del concetto iniziale. Non tutti i progetti di app raggiungono il successo: solo poche app originali si affacciano attualmente sul mercato. Per massimizzare le tue possibilità, dovrai essere critico e oggettivo fin dall’inizio.


Validazione del concetto iniziale

Per validare la tua idea, considera questi aspetti chiave:

  • Identifica il problema specifico che la tua app intende risolvere
  • Valuta l’unicità della soluzione proposta
  • Verifica che l’app offra un reale valore aggiunto per gli utenti


Analisi della domanda di mercato

L’analisi di mercato è essenziale per comprendere la fattibilità del tuo progetto. Utilizza strumenti come:

  1. Google Analytics per ottenere dati demografici
  2. Servizi specializzati di ricerca di mercato
  3. Indagini dirette con potenziali utenti


Studio della concorrenza

Un’accurata ricognizione del panorama competitivo ti aiuterà a:

  • Identificare gap nel mercato
  • Comprendere le funzionalità già esistenti
  • Analizzare feedback e recensioni di app simili

Ricorda: il successo di un’app dipende dalla sua capacità di migliorare concretamente l’esperienza degli utenti, offrendo una soluzione innovativa e user-friendly.


Idea app come svilupparla: La fase di pianificazione strategica

Quando hai un’idea per un’app, la fase di pianificazione strategica diventa cruciale per trasformare il tuo concetto in un progetto realizzabile. Sviluppare un’app richiede un approccio metodico e attento che riduca i rischi e massimizzi le possibilità di successo.

Ecco i passaggi chiave per pianificare strategicamente il tuo progetto di app:

  • Definizione degli obiettivi: Chiarisci con precisione cosa vuoi ottenere con la tua app
  • Identificazione del pubblico target
  • Creazione di un business plan solido
  • Stabilimento di un budget realistico
  • Definizione di una timeline di sviluppo

Per sviluppare l’idea app in modo efficace, dovrai concentrarti su alcuni aspetti strategici fondamentali. L’analisi dei rischi di progetto è essenziale: i 7 rischi più comuni includono problemi di comunicazione, slittamento degli obiettivi e allocazione inadeguata delle risorse.

Un elemento chiave per ho l’idea per un app come faccio a svilupparla è la creazione di un MVP (Minimum Viable Product). Questo approccio ti permette di testare la tua idea sul mercato con un investimento minimo, riducendo i rischi finanziari e validando il concetto iniziale.

L’analisi SWOT può essere un ottimo strumento per valutare la fattibilità della tua app, identificando punti di forza, debolezze, opportunità e minacce del progetto.


Scegliere la tecnologia giusta per la tua app

Quando hai un’idea ma non sai sviluppare un’app, la scelta della tecnologia diventa cruciale. La tua decisione influenzerà l’intero processo di sviluppo, i costi e le prestazioni future dell’applicazione.

La tecnologia rappresenta il cuore pulsante di ogni progetto digitale. Come sviluppare un’idea di app richiede una valutazione attenta delle diverse opzioni disponibili sul mercato.

Sviluppo nativo vs ibrido: Pro e contro

Le principali strategie di sviluppo app prevedono due approcci fondamentali:

  • Sviluppo nativo: Prestazioni elevate ma costi maggiori
  • Sviluppo ibrido: Copertura multipiattaforma con performance ridotte

Piattaforme di sviluppo principali

Le piattaforme più utilizzate per lo sviluppo di app includono:

  1. React Native
  2. Flutter
  3. Xamarin
  4. Swift per iOS
  5. Kotlin per Android

Considerazioni sui costi di sviluppo

I costi di sviluppo variano significativamente:

  • App semplice: $25,000 – $50,000
  • App media: $125,000 – $200,000
  • App complessa: Oltre $200,000

La scelta della tecnologia dipende dal tuo budget, obiettivi e target di mercato. Valuta attentamente ogni opzione per massimizzare il successo del tuo progetto.


Design Sprint: Metodologia per lo sviluppo rapido

Quando hai un’app da sviluppare, la metodologia Design Sprint rappresenta una soluzione innovativa per trasformare rapidamente la tua idea app come svilupparla in un prototipo funzionale. Ideata da un designer di Google Venture, questa tecnica consente di accelerare il processo di sviluppo in soli cinque giorni.

Il Design Sprint si articola in fasi cruciali che permettono di:

  • Mappare il problema centrale del progetto
  • Generare soluzioni creative attraverso lo sketching
  • Prendere decisioni strategiche
  • Creare un prototipo veloce
  • Testare il prodotto con utenti reali

I vantaggi di questa metodologia sono significativi. Rispetto al modello Waterfall tradizionale, che richiede normalmente un anno per rilasciare un’app, il Design Sprint ti permette di:

  1. Risparmiare tempo prezioso
  2. Ridurre i costi di sviluppo
  3. Ottenere feedback immediati
  4. Validare rapidamente la fattibilità della tua idea

Scegliendo il Design Sprint, trasformerai la tua idea in un prototipo testabile, minimizzando i rischi e massimizzando le opportunità di successo del tuo progetto di app.


Prototipazione e test dell’app

Quando hai un’idea per un’app, il primo passo cruciale è trasformare il tuo concetto in qualcosa di tangibile. Come sviluppare un’idea di app richiede una fase di prototipazione accurata che ti permetterà di visualizzare e testare la tua visione prima dell’effettivo sviluppo software.

La prototipazione rappresenta un momento fondamentale nel percorso di creazione di un’applicazione digitale. Permette di:

  • Visualizzare il design dell’interfaccia
  • Verificare l’esperienza utente
  • Identificare potenziali criticità
  • Risparmiare risorse economiche

Creazione del mockup funzionale

Per creare un mockup efficace, utilizza strumenti professionali come Figma o Adobe XD. Questi permettono di generare prototipi interattivi con un’accuratezza fino al 99%, simulando il comportamento reale dell’applicazione.

Raccolta feedback degli utenti

Il feedback degli utenti è essenziale per migliorare il tuo prototipo. Coinvolgi un campione rappresentativo del tuo target market, utilizzando tecniche come:

  1. Test A/B per confrontare diverse versioni
  2. Interviste dirette con potenziali utilizzatori
  3. Analisi dei comportamenti durante l’utilizzo

Iterazioni e miglioramenti

Non considerare il primo prototipo come versione finale. Preparati a iterare più volte, implementando i suggerimenti raccolti. Ricorda che modificare un prototipo è molto meno costoso che correggere un’app già sviluppata.


Pubblicazione e distribuzione dell’app

Quando hai un’app da sviluppare, la fase di pubblicazione diventa cruciale. Nel 2023, milioni di applicazioni sono disponibili sugli store digitali, rendendo la distribuzione un passaggio strategico per il successo del tuo progetto. Scegliere la piattaforma giusta richiede una valutazione attenta delle tue esigenze di sviluppo e del target di utenti.

Per l’idea app come svilupparla in modo efficace, dovrai considerare le diverse piattaforme come App Store e Google Play. Ogni store ha requisiti specifici: Apple, ad esempio, ha un processo di revisione accurato che può durare da poche ore a diversi giorni. La preparazione dei materiali promozionali, come screenshot di qualità e descrizioni chiare, aumenterà le tue possibilità di approvazione.

L’ottimizzazione per gli store (ASO) è fondamentale. Seleziona parole chiave appropriate per migliorare la visibilità nei risultati di ricerca. L’integrazione di strumenti come Google Analytics ti permetterà di monitorare il coinvolgimento degli utenti e raccogliere dati preziosi per futuri miglioramenti dell’applicazione.

Ricorda che la pubblicazione non è un punto di arrivo, ma l’inizio di un percorso. Prevedi aggiornamenti regolari, risolvi eventuali bug tempestivamente e mantieni alta la qualità dell’esperienza utente per garantire il successo a lungo termine della tua app.

Ti è piaciuto l’articolo? Il nostro team é esperto in progettazione e realizzazione di prodotti digitali e realizziamo progetti di intelligenza artificiale. Siamo pronti a guidarti in ogni fase del tuo progetto, dalla concezione alla realizzazione. Se hai un’idea in mente, contattaci per una consulenza completamente gratuita e senza impegno!

Altri articoli che potrebbero interessarti

L'analisi dei requisiti di una app da sviluppare rappresenta il punto di partenza cruciale...
SviluppoTecnologia

Meta sfida ChatGpt: ha infatti lanciato la sua nuova intelligenza artificiale, Meta AI, con...

Tecnologia